Texas's climate significantly influences home repair demands. The intense summer heat in areas like Grand Prairie and Killeen necessitates robust HVAC maintenance and checks for insulation efficiency. Winter freezes, though less frequent in some regions, can cause plumbing issues. High humidity along the coast can lead to problems with wood rot, paint, and mold. Permitting in Texas is often handled at the city or county level, with specific requirements varying by location. In Texas, be cautious of providers who lack verifiable references or examples of previous work. Poor communication regarding the project's process and expected completion is also a concern. If a provider insists on a large upfront payment or seems hesitant to discuss necessary permits for certain jobs, it warrants further scrutiny. A professional will clearly outline each step.

For many routine repair and maintenance tasks in Texas, a specific state handyman license isn't always mandated. However, for certain jobs, like significant electrical or plumbing work, a licensed professional might be required. Always confirm if the work requires a license and if the handyman carries adequate liability insurance for your protection.
